- The US Space Weather Prediction Center (SWPC) confirmed that the X1-class solar flare currently erupted from a sunspot called AR2887.
- It was positioned in the centre of the Sun and facing the Earth, based on its location.
- The geomagnetic storm that hit Earth on October 30 has been rated as G3 on the 5-step scale of ranking of solar events.
- The impact of a G3 solar storm is generally nominal.
